## Deployment: Cold Starts

Penna handlers on the Driftbay runtime incur cold starts of 1–3 seconds when scaled from zero. We mitigate this with pre-warmed concurrency and a keepalive ping every four minutes. Review these numbers at the weekly sync before changing limits. The current warm-pool configuration values follow directly below.

config for kafof-bawef:
holath:
  log_level: debug
  metrics_host: metrics.holath.qorvelsys.internal
  pin: 2191
  pool_size: 32

Heads-up for the weekly sync: we're upgrading the Pellsworth message broker from version 4 to 5 over the next two sprints. The main change is that consumer acknowledgements become mandatory, so any service still using fire-and-forget mode must be patched first. Staging moves this week; production follows once the queue-depth metrics hold steady for five days. Owners of affected services should confirm readiness before Friday. The migration checklist, rollback steps, and service status tracker are maintained on the internal page below.

runbook for badug-kadup: https://confluence.zemvarlabs.internal/projects/browse/display/projects/bd1b

Finance Review Summary — Veltrix Launch Plan. Board copy. Projected launch spend for the Quanta Hub line is within envelope; marketing allocation trimmed 8%. Break-even now modeled at month eleven, assuming Kestrel Region distribution holds. Pricing approved by committee; inventory pre-build capped at 40k units. Risks: supplier concentration at Dornfield Plastics. No further capital requested this quarter. The confidential note on business plans follows below.

board note of kageg-bahof: The renewal with Holwynax Holdings closes at $2 million a year, 5 percent below the last contract. Project Ulaath slips by two quarters because of the supplier delay.

# Env Vars — Pixelgrove Snapshot Tests

Hey on-call folks: if the snapshot suite for Pixelgrove's UI components starts failing everywhere at once, it's almost never the components. Check snapshots.env first. The renderer needs the headless browser path, the baseline bucket name, and a viewport scale of 1 (seriously, don't change it). The baseline bucket won't authorize pulls without its access credential, which goes on the line right after the bucket name.

vault entry, yahif-yajep: COURIER_KEY29=b802bdf8034096b65a51c6ba5abe2